Critical History

Left side altar of St Corbinian with the statues of the Sts Benno and Rupert with the Madonna of Altötting. The tabernacle has the relief "Christ in Emmaus" and two lateral angels. The altar is crowned with an angel with a bishop insignia.

Altarpiece "St Corbinian" by J. J. Zeiller, 1761.

The work is testified by Lippert and the bills have been preserved (Munich, archives of the Archdiocese of Munich and Freising, Pfarrsachen Ettal).1

On 23 July 1759 a second contract was signed in Ettal for the Korbiniansaltar (northern cross altar) and the pulpit "nach dem proiectierten und zu übergeben seyenten Modell und dernahlen gemachten Verzaichnus Riss". Straub was to do the sculptures "zierlichist und in solcher Macht und Vollkommenheit, wie den ersten verförthigen, her- und aufstellen, wie auch die versprochene Modell, sowohl vor sich selbst als auch unser Kistler zur rechten Zeit herrichten und einschicken". The work was to be completed in the autumn of the following year. For this work Straub received 850 florins. The last payment was made in November 1760.
